Analysis
Nepal recorded 124 for mean hemoglobin level of women of reproductive age in 2019. That is the highest value across all 20 years on record.
Compared with earlier readings it is up 0.8% over ten years.
Over the whole period, mean hemoglobin level of women of reproductive age in Nepal peaked at 124 in 2011 and was at its lowest, 120, in 2000.
That places Nepal 135th out of 194 countries with data for 2019, putting it in the middle of the range.
Mean hemoglobin level of women of reproductive age in Nepal, year by year
| Year | Value | Change |
|---|---|---|
| 2000 | 120 | — |
| 2001 | 120 | +0.0% |
| 2002 | 121 | +0.8% |
| 2003 | 121 | +0.0% |
| 2004 | 122 | +0.8% |
| 2005 | 122 | +0.0% |
| 2006 | 122 | +0.0% |
| 2007 | 123 | +0.8% |
| 2008 | 123 | +0.0% |
| 2009 | 123 | +0.0% |
| 2010 | 123 | +0.0% |
| 2011 | 124 | +0.8% |
| 2012 | 124 | +0.0% |
| 2013 | 124 | +0.0% |
| 2014 | 124 | +0.0% |
| 2015 | 124 | +0.0% |
| 2016 | 124 | +0.0% |
| 2017 | 124 | +0.0% |
| 2018 | 124 | +0.0% |
| 2019 | 124 | +0.0% |
